DT10 1DT is a sought-after residential area located 0.7km from Rixon in Sturminster Newton. Administratively it sits within Sturminster Newton ward and the North Dorset constituency.

One of the more sought-after postcodes in DT10, DT10 1DT offers a quiet rural community with low density and high home ownership. The daytime character shifts — includes some mining and quarrying and other industrial activity. With an average age of 47, this is established family country — quiet streets, strong community ties, and low rental churn. 79% of residents own their home — above average for the district, consistent with a stable and sought-after address.

Safety: Crime rates are low here at 20 incidents per 1,000 residents — well below average and reassuring for families.

Census 2021 statistics for DT10 1DT are sourced from Output Area E00103703 (shared with 13 postcodes in this micro-neighbourhood). Property prices come from HM Land Registry.
